use crate::common::utils;
pub fn npv(rate: f64, values: &[f64]) -> f64 {
if rate == 0.0 {
return values.iter().sum();
}
utils::powers(1. + rate, values.len(), false)
.iter()
.zip(values.iter())
.map(|(p, v)| v / p)
.sum()
}
